Try decreasing your mileage each year to boost the savings on your insurance bill. Less time behind the wheel can mean a lower premium for you.
Try to keep a good driving records. When accidents and tickets are on your driving record, your insurance costs can go through the roof. There are times when you can't avoid the accident or ticket, so you should check out traffic school to see if this will help clean your record and make your insurance premiums lower.
Many states make you have liability insurance if you drive. It is up to you to find out whether your state has such a law and, if it does, make sure you are in compliance with it. You are breaking the law if you drive uninsured.
Before you buy auto insurance, always ask multiple companies for quotes. Rates can be very different depending on which company you choose. Get new quotes every year to ensure the lowest premiums and out-pocket-costs. Just be careful to make sure that the quotes are offering the same levels of insurance when reviewing.
Avoid the purchase of pricey after-market items for your vehicle that are not really necessary. You don't need heated seats or fancy stereos. Your insurance won't repay you for damage if your vehicle is stolen.
Pay for your car insurance quarterly or bi-annually rather than month-by-month. Your insurance company could be adding an additional three to five dollars to your bill. These extra fees can become significant over time. Adding another bill to your monthly pile can also turn into a nuisance. The less payments you have to make, the better.
It's a good idea to buy property damage liability when you are purchasing auto insurance. If you cause property damage in an accident, this type of coverage will protect your assets. 47 states require you to buy this type of insurance. If you are even involved in an accident, property damage liability can protect you from losing a large sum of money.
The cheapest quote may not necessarily be the best policy. The cheap insurance you found might have gaps in coverage, but it might also be a diamond in the rough. It will be necessary to research the carrier and policy details prior to putting your faith in the notion that you will indeed receive proper compensation if an accident occurs.
There are many aspects to car insurance and one small part of comparing quotes is to look at the annual premium costs. Make sure you get information on all of a policy's details, such as the amount of your deductible if you are involved in an accident, the limits that are placed on any benefits you receive and the levels on your various types of coverage.
